twentyfold
Adjective
/ˈtwɛntiˌfoʊld/

Definition
Equivalent to twenty times as much or as many.

Examples
- If production increases twentyfold, we can expect a substantial rise in revenue.
- The use of the technology has improved efficiency twentyfold.
- After the campaign, the company’s reach expanded twentyfold.

Meaning
The term ‘twentyfold’ signifies an increase or multiplication by a factor of twenty. It is often used to indicate that something has grown significantly, not just in terms of quantity but also in impact or value.

Synonyms
- twenty times
- twenty times over
